VERONA, NJ — Verona will have a hometown connection to root for in the first Garden State Culinary Arts Awards.

According to the Garden State Culinary Arts Awards, Ariane Duarte of Ariane Kitchen & Bar in Verona was nominated in the Outstanding Chef category.

All candidates in the competition will receive votes from 100 independent judges around the state, including journalists, food writers, cookbook authors and other culinary experts. The top three vote-getters in each category will be announced publicly in April, and after a follow up vote, the final winners will be announced on Saturday, May 6, during a ceremony presented by Buy-Rite Liquors.
